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: The fate of all rests in the hands of three outcasts. Elves are at war with Men all because of the act of a single elf one-thousand years ago. A band of nefarious elves known as The Dire now threatens to overthrow the Land of Elvendore. Tarren - a hot-blooded boy - has sworn to kill every elf he meets. Silliss - an exiled elf with a price on his head - has a burning hatred of humans. Shiloh - a ranger with a mysterious past - has a hidden agenda of his own. These three unlikely companions set out on an adventure that could end in either peace or the destruction of Elvendore. Follow Shiloh, Silliss, and Tarren as they travel into forbidden forests guarded by sentient trees; get captured by slavers; delve into dwarven mines; escape The Dire; stumble across hidden civilizations; and tangle with dangerous dragons.
